Real Madrid star to face three-match ban for assault on player

Ronaldo who was recently awarded the World's Best Player kicked and punched Edimar in the second half of the clash against Cordoba to earn the ninth red card of his career​
Advertisement

A different Ronaldo must have played the game against Cordoba on Saturday as the Portugal international for the first time in a long while was sent off; the ninth of his career.

Advertisement

The 29 year-old kicked and slapped the home sides’ Brazilian defender, Edimar Fraga midway through the second half, an incident frowned upon by the referee who’d have the 2014 FIFA Ballon D’Or winner no more on the pitch.

The red card ended a frustrating afternoon for Ronaldo who should have been sent off earlier in the game with a similar incident on another Cordoba player.

"I apologise to everyone and especially Edimar for my thoughtless action in today's game," Ronaldo wrote via twitter.
